Background
Cross-Organisational Mentoring Circles (COMC) creates a supportive space to connect Black, Asian, Mixed Race, and other ethnically diverse employees across our Responsible Business Network.
Participants are matched with professionals from different organisations to share experiences, challenges, and aspirations while working in mentoring circles. These circles are led by senior leaders from participating organisations, who facilitate conversations and learning over a six-month period.
Through this programme, your organisation can offer mentoring opportunities—either in addition to or in place of setting up your own programme—demonstrating your commitment to race equality, inclusion, and workplace diversity.
